With winter in full swing, I wanted to bring back some of our water play by incorporating a water pouring sensory bin.

I started by collecting bath toys that we already had in our home then added in water, measuring cups and funnels. If you are playing inside, I recommend placing an absorbent bath mat or towel underneath the bin to catch any splashes.

Supply List
- 1 Plastic storage bin
- I used the Sterlite 28qt under bed storage bin
- Water
- Funnels
- Measuring cups or scoops
Optional Supplies
- Bath toys
- Water table accessories
- Sponges
- Bath mat and towels
- Additional water-safe items

For infants and toddlers, this activity can be done with smaller quantities of water and no scoops to minimize spills. As with any water activity, children should always be supervised.
